| Word | Word Type | Definition |
|---|---|---|
| Lecher | n. | A man given to lewdness; one addicted, in an excessive degree, to the indulgence of sexual desire, or to illicit commerce with women. |
| Lecher | v. i. | To practice lewdness. |
